New Award Announced for Theology Majors
The Office of University Advancement is pleased to announce the creation of the Hico Seventh-day Adventist Church Student Award.
The Hico Seventh-day Adventist Church in Hico, Texas has established a new award at Southwestern Adventist University. This award recipient will be determined by the Department of Theology, and will provide a minimum of $1,000 per year to the student who meets the following criteria:
- Currently enrolled at Southwestern Adventist University
- An individual who is responding to a personal call to the ministry, as determined by faculty in the Department of Theology
- Is pursuing a major in Theology
- Is maintaining an overall GPA of at least 2.5
